A new study from NAHB tracked the impact of USDA single-family loan programs on new construction: the Section 502 Direct Loan Program and the Section 502 Guaranteed Loan Program.
The programs are intended to support homeownership during down periods in the economy, when obtaining a conventional loan is difficult.
